Output 65e03a74a08c9491d0bd79dddce79232bfe3f9c90936b96dde9310f17434653e:0

value
879445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51d2a7c0eb9d9cd77fb15f22daf5010ecaad99c6 OP_EQUAL
address
MFMoKZ7LCQEYwbUn5aKn3sPPJdDFM4Bbv7
transaction
65e03a74a08c9491d0bd79dddce79232bfe3f9c90936b96dde9310f17434653e
spent
true